.select2-dropdown-autowidth {
    /*width: auto !important;*/
}

.select2-dropdown-autowidth > .select2-search--dropdown,
.select2-dropdown-autowidth > .s2-togall-button {
    background-color: #337ab7;
    color: white;
    display: block;
}

#ticketing-dynagrid-1 {
    padding-top: 88px;
}

@media only screen and (min-width: 1020px) {
    #ticketing-dynagrid-1 {
        padding-top: 44px;
    }
}

@media only screen and (min-width: 1780px) {
    #ticketing-dynagrid-1 {
        padding-top: 0;
    }
}

#systems-list-grid-1 {
    padding-top: 44px;
}

@media only screen and (min-width: 1300px) {
    #systems-list-grid-1 {
        padding-top: 0;
    }
}

#ticketing-grid-1 > .btn-group, #systems-list-grid-1 > .btn-group {
    float: left;
    margin-right: 10px;
}
@media only screen and (min-width: 1020px) {
    #ticketing-grid-1 > .btn-group,
    #systems-list-grid-1 > .btn-group {
        float: right;
        margin-right: 0;
        margin-left: 10px;
    }
}

.dynagrid-flex-toolbar {
    display: flex;
    gap: 10px;
    flex-wrap: wrap;
    z-index: 101;
    position: relative;
}
@media only screen and (min-width: 1320px) {
    #systems-list-grid-1 .dynagrid-flex-toolbar {
        float: right;
    }
}
@media only screen and (min-width: 1020px) {
    #ticketing-grid-1 .dynagrid-flex-toolbar {
        float: right;
    }
}


        @media only screen and (min-width: 1020px) {
            #ticketing-grid-1 > .btn-group {
                float: right;
                margin-right: 0;
                margin-left: 10px;
            }
        }

        #ticketing-dynagrid-1 .select2-selection__choice, #systems-list-page-dynagrid-1 .select2-selection__choice {
        padding-right: 17px;
    }

    #ticketing-dynagrid-1 .select2-selection__choice__remove,
    #systems-list-page-dynagrid-1 .select2-selection__choice__remove {
        margin-right: -12px;
    }

    .select2-dropdown-nosearchbox .select2-search__field {
        display: none;
    }

    #ticketing-dynagrid-1 .select2-selection--multiple,
    #systems-list-page-dynagrid-1 .select2-selection--multiple {
        padding-right: 20px;
    }

    .select2-dropdown-nosearchbox .select2-selection__clear {
        margin-right: 6px !important;
        right: 0 !important;
    }

    .select2-dropdown-nosearchbox ul.select2-selection__rendered {
        margin-bottom: 5px !important;
    }